Freigeben über


ITfCreatePropertyStore::IsStoreSerializable-Methode (msctf.h)

Bestimmt, ob ein Eigenschaftenspeicher als persistente Daten gespeichert werden kann.

Syntax

HRESULT IsStoreSerializable(
  [in]  REFGUID          guidProp,
  [in]  ITfRange         *pRange,
  [in]  ITfPropertyStore *pPropStore,
  [out] BOOL             *pfSerializable
);

Parameter

[in] guidProp

Enthält den Typbezeichner der -Eigenschaft. Weitere Informationen finden Sie unter ITfPropertyStore::GetType.

[in] pRange

Zeiger auf ein ITfRange-Objekt , das den text enthält, der vom Eigenschaftenspeicher abgedeckt wird.

[in] pPropStore

Zeiger auf das ITfPropertyStore-Objekt .

[out] pfSerializable

Zeiger auf eine BOOL , die ein Flag empfängt, das angibt, ob der Eigenschaftenspeicher serialisiert werden kann. Empfängt nonzero, wenn der Eigenschaftenspeicher serialisiert oder andernfalls null serialisiert werden kann.

Rückgabewert

Diese Methode kann einen dieser Werte zurückgeben.

Wert BESCHREIBUNG
S_OK
Die Methode war erfolgreich.

Anforderungen

   
Unterstützte Mindestversion (Client) Windows 2000 Professional [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ows 2000 Server [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ile msctf.h
DLL Tiptsf.dll
Verteilbare Komponente TSF 1.0 unter Windows 2000 Professional

Weitere Informationen

ITfCreatePropertyStore-Schnittstelle, ITfPropertyStore-Schnittstelle, ITfPropertyStore::GetType, ITfRange-Schnittstelle